Rams take Terrance Ferguson with their first pick in the draft
Photo by Jevone Moore/Icon Sportswire via Getty Images

Rams address tight end early in the 2025 draft

With the 46th pick in the 2025 NFL Draft, the Los Angeles Rams selected Oregon tight end Terrance Ferguson. A year after speculation that the Rams were interested in trading up for Brock Bowers, general manager Les Snead has gone back to the tight end position by picking Ferguson with L.A.’s first choice in the 2025 draft.

Will Ferguson finally be the franchise tight end heir apparent to Tyler Higbee that the Rams have been seeking for years?

Since drafting Higbee in 2016, the Rams have picked the likes of Gerald Everett, Brycen Hopkins, and Jacob Harris, but none were able to secure long-term roles in L.A. In 2023, the Rams drafted Davis Allen in the fifth.

But now Ferguson is one of the highest drafted tight ends in the history of the Rams franchise.

Ferguson is 6’5, 247 lbs and he ran a 4.63 40-yard dash at the combine with a 1.55 10-yard split and an impressive 39” vertical. He set school records for career receptions with 134 and touchdowns with 16. Last season, Ferguson had 43 catches for 591 yards.

Lance Zierlein projected Ferguson to be a third round pick. The Rams traded down with the Falcons from 26 to 46 and now they’ve taken him in the middle of the second.
